REVIEWED TRACKER MODULE

this module is now maintained and supported by Edunao (French Moodle Partner)

By Valery Fremaux.

This module is a complete redraw of the former tracker module.

It provides a complete ticket tracking activity with following features :

  • Customizable ticket form submission
  • Commentable ticket records
  • Ticket assignation management
  • Ticket priority
  • Rich ticket listing using flexible table
  • "My tickets" list as author
  • "My assigned ticket" list
  • Closed or solved tickets separate archive
  • Multicriteria search engine
  • Search query personal memo
  • Watch management
  • Notification service (parametric)
  • Full backup/restore implementation
  • Tracking activity reports

Default installation instructions for plugins of the type Activities

  1. Make sure you have all the required versions.
  2. Download and unpack the module.
  3. Place the folder (eg "assignment") in the "mod" subdirectory.
  4. Visit http://yoursite.com/admin to finish the installation
